There will be some Canadian content at UFC Atlanta.
Canada's Jamey-Lyn Horth will take on Czechia's Tereza Bledá at the UFC Fight Night event on June 14, the UFC confirmed on Wednesday.
Horth, 35, is 7-2 in her UFC career and ranked 38th in the women's flyweight division.
The Squamish, B.C., native lost her last fight to Miranda Maverick by unanimous decision on a UFC Fight Night card in December.
Bledá, 23, is 7-1 for her career and is ranked No. 40.
